Bankruptcy and your property

Friday, October 26th, 2007

The filing of a bankruptcy does not mean you will lose all your property. Starting with cars and houses that have a lien. If you want to keep them , you can as long as you continue to make the normal payments. You will usually reaffirm the debt which means agree to continue make all […]

Advantages of Chapter 13 Bankruptcy

Thursday, October 25th, 2007

A chapter 13 bankruptcy is used most of the time to save your home from a foreclosure sale. The foreclosure sale is happening because you have fallen several house payments behind and you and the mortgage company can’t agree on a payback plan. The chapter 13 will allow you up to five years to pay […]
